201 J3 stainless steel coil belongs to high-manganese, low-nickel austenitic stainless steel. Due to its relatively higher carbon content and lower copper content, its ductility is weaker than grades such as J1 and J4. It is not suitable for large-angle bending (such as >150°) or deep drawing applications, otherwise cracking or internal fractures may occur. Therefore, it is more suitable for decorative and structural applications that require strength, hardness, and good surface appearance, but do not involve complex forming processes.

Chemical Composition (%)
| Carbon (C) | Manganese (Mn) | Phosphorus (P) | Sulfur (S) | Silicon (Si) | Chromium (Cr) | Nickel (Ni) | Copper (Cu) | Nitrogen (N) |
| ≤ 0.15 | 9.0 - 11.5 | ≤ 0.060 | ≤ 0.030 | ≤ 0.75 | 12.0 - 14.0 | 0.5 - 0.8 | 0.3 - 0.5 | ≤ 0.25 |
Mechanical Properties
| Property | Value (Typical) | Comparison Note |
| Tensile Strength (σb) | ≥ 530 MPa | Higher than J1 |
| Yield Strength (σ0.2) | ≥ 245 MPa | High stiffness |
| Elongation (δ5) | 25% - 35% | Lower ductility than J1 |
| Hardness (HV) | 210 - 250 | Very High |
| Hardness (HRB) | 92 - 98 | Hard/Brittle |
201 J3 Stainless Steel Coil Applications
Decorative Tubing: Straight pipes for handrails and window frames (minimal bending).
Structural Parts: Frames for furniture, racking systems, and shelving units.
Hardware: Low-end hinges, brackets, and simple stamped components.
Kitchen Accessories: Simple trays, racks, and items without deep-stretched shapes.
Construction: Indoor decorative strips and trim.
What is the differences between 201 J1 J2 J3 Stainless Steel Coil?
The 201 J-series stainless steel coils (J1, J2, J3, J4, J5) are variants differentiated by their carbon and copper content, which dictates their hardness, formability, and corrosion resistance. Generally, J4 has the highest copper and best deep-drawing performance (most expensive), J1 is the standard all-rounder, and J2/J3 are higher-carbon, harder, and better for simple, flat, or structural uses.
